depressor muscle
In Cirripedia (Balanomorpha), muscle inserted at basicarnial angle of tergum, for which depressor muscle crests are usually developed [Moore and McCormick, 1969].
Muscle inserted at basicarinal angle of tergum (balanomorph Cirripedia) [McLaughlin, 1980].
The muscle which moves the limb downwards by rotating it about the CB joint [Warner, 1977].
(Subclass Cirripedia):
In stalked barnacle, one of several paired muscles spanning from tergum and scutum to basis; serves in closing aperture [Stachowitsch, 1992].
